Transaction 337040e15dca34feeaffd41b06e1734b507598168871f594bdacc8c0bbae9a70

2 Input
2 Outputs
  • 337040e15dca34feeaffd41b06e1734b507598168871f594bdacc8c0bbae9a70:0
  • value  672129
    address  3Q4tFZkgHmY1nSqAhfE9d9LXX8kA7VHJKj
  • 337040e15dca34feeaffd41b06e1734b507598168871f594bdacc8c0bbae9a70:1
  • value  1353556
    address  3FyT8MupZGH4NGHbEXgJc17EBX6i73sbYH